Sydney Kings one victory away from NBL championship

28 March 2026
in Australia
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ter



The Sydney Kings are one win away from clinching the NBL championship after defeating the Adelaide 36ers 106-93 in Game 3 of the finals. Kendric Davis led the Kings with an impressive performance, scoring 34 points and providing 15 assists, making him the first player in NBL history to achieve 30 points and 10 assists in a championship game. The match, attended by a record crowd of 18,373, saw Davis outperform his rival, Bryce Cotton, who managed only 15 points and had five turnovers. The game was tightly contested, with 30 lead changes until the Kings broke away in the final quarter, starting with a 7-0 run. The Kings now hold a 2-1 lead in the best-of-five series and can secure their sixth championship title in Game 4 on Wednesday.

Why It Matters

This victory positions the Sydney Kings on the brink of their sixth NBL championship, marking a significant moment in the league’s history. Kendric Davis’s performance not only highlights his individual talent but also underscores the competitive nature of the finals, especially against a player of Bryce Cotton’s caliber. The attendance record set during this game reflects the growing popularity of the NBL and its fan engagement. Historically, the Kings have been a strong team in the league, and winning this championship would further solidify their legacy in Australian basketball.
